Summary

Ignacio Middle School is a public middle school in Ignacio, Colorado, serving 155 students in grades 6-8. The school is part of the Ignacio School District No. 11Jt, which is ranked 101 out of 115 districts in the state and has a 1-star rating from SchoolDigger.

Ignacio Middle School consistently underperforms compared to the state average on CMAS assessments in English Language Arts, Math, and Science. For example, in the 2024-2025 school year, only 37% of students were proficient or better in ELA, compared to the state average of 44.8%. The school also has relatively high dropout rates, ranging from 0.8% to 2.2% over the past few years, and extremely high chronic absenteeism rates, ranging from 27.7% to 48.2% in recent years. These metrics are significantly higher than the state averages.

While Ignacio Middle School's overall performance is low, there are notable differences in performance between male and female students, with male students consistently outperforming their female counterparts. Additionally, the school's low-income students (those eligible for free or reduced-price lunch) perform relatively better compared to the overall school, ranking 152 out of 244 Colorado middle schools in this subgroup in the 2023-2024 school year. Nearby schools like Miller Middle School and Mountain Middle School consistently outperform Ignacio Middle School on CMAS assessments, indicating that addressing the school's challenges will require a comprehensive approach, including targeted interventions and increased resources.
